WBB | Gaels Host No. 16 Gonzaga, Pepperdine This Week

MORAGA, Calif. - The Saint Mary's Women's Basketball team will be hosting No. 16 Gonzaga Thursday at 4:30 p.m. and Pepperdine Saturday at 5:00 p.m.. 

 

SMC has a 28-50 all time record against the Bulldogs, with Gonzaga winning seven-straight match ups. When Saint Mary's played Gonzaga earlier this season, the Bulldogs won each quarter and kept at least a 15-point lead throughout the game. 

 

With a 45-35 overall record against Pepperdine, Saint Mary's took down Pepperdine last season defeating them twice. In their previous match, the Gaels came out and dominated in the second quarter, keeping The Waves to only five points. The Gaels will look to push their win streak to three against Pepperdine.

LAST TIMEOUT

Saint Mary's Women's Basketball battled hard against Santa Clara this past Saturday, losing 70-58 and ending the Gaels five game win streak. 

 

The Gaels were trailing ealy in the game, but Ali Bamberer kept the Broncos from no more than a seven point lead in the first quarter. SCU went up by 13 in the second quarter, but a three pointer made by Makena Mastora and a jumper by Hannah Rapp kept the Bronco lead to nine ending the half.  

 

Santa Clara came out of the half strong with a 7-0 run and just three minutes into the third quarter, the Broncos had a score of 38-22 over the Gaels. SCU took a 19 point lead with two minutes left in the third. 

 

Saint Mary's started the fourth quarter hot with a 9-0 run and was capped by a Leia Hanafin three-pointer to cut the deficit to eight with 6:23 left in the game. The Broncos went back up by 14 with 3:37 remaining, but Hanafin did it again with just two minutes left on the clock, hitting a three to make it a 62-54 game. The Broncos never let SMC get any closer than eight points to close out the game within those last two minutes. 

 

ABOUT GONZAGA

The Bulldogs are coming off of a very strong 2022-2023 season with a 28-5 overall record and a 17-1 conference record, only losing to Santa Clara by five. The Zags continue to dominate this season, only losing twice, once to No. 24 Washington State 77-72 in overtime and No. 20 Louisville 81-70. Although Gonzaga fell short to those teams, they defeated No. 3 Stanford 96-78. 

 

The Bulldog to watch out for is Senior forward Yvonnw Ejim. Ejim is the team leader in various categories with 487 points, 75 offensive rebounds and 124 defensive rebounds, giving her 199 total. She averages 20.3 points per game and is third in assists (51). The senior has won Conference Player of the week four times this season, has been named one of 10 semifinalist for the 2024 Becky Hammon Mid-Major Player of the Year Award, has been named to the Naismith Trophy Women's College Player of the Year Midseason Team (one of 30 player in the nation named to the list), and also has been named to Canada's Senior Women's National Team to help qualify Team Canada for the Olympics this summer. 

 

ABOUT PEPPERDINE

The Waves are in a stump this season with a 10 game lose streak, only defeating conference opener San Diego 53-52 for conference. Senior Jane Nwaba is Pepperdine's leading scorer with 237 points this season. She also leads her team with 183 rebounds, 72 assists, 31 steals, and is second in blocks with 17.
